The small shuffle algebra action conjecture for the entire K-theory

From papers

Let SS be the surface under consideration, let \CVsm\CV_\emph{sm} be its small shuffle algebra, and let K\CMK_\CM denote the entire K-theory group in place of the tautological part K\CMK_\CM'. Under Assumption A, the action is understood as an abelian group homomorphism assigning to each R(z1,,zk)\CVsmR(z_1,\ldots,z_k)\in\CV_\emph{sm} a homomorphism from K\CMK_\CM to K\CM×SkK_{\CM\times S^k}, with composition governed by the shuffle product as in Corollary. Small shuffle algebra action conjecture. Under Assumption A, there is an action

\CVsmK\CM\CV_\emph{sm}\curvearrowright K_\CM

where

δ(z1z)\delta\left(\frac{z_1}{z}\right)

acts as e(z)e(z) of the defining formula for e(z)e(z). The notion of action is defined as in Corollary. This is the expected extension of the action from the tautological K-theory group under Assumption B to the entire K-theory group under Assumption A; the supplied text gives no resolution, so the conjecture remains open.
